First, we stop the source. Whether it’s a burst pipe, storm damage, or appliance failure, we identify and control the water source immediately. No point in cleaning up if more water keeps coming in.

Next comes complete water extraction. We’re not talking about shop vacuums here. Our industrial-grade pumps and extraction equipment remove standing water fast, including water that’s soaked into floors, walls, and other materials you might not think about.

Then we dry everything thoroughly. Using professional dehumidifiers, air movers, and moisture detection equipment, we make sure every trace of moisture is gone. This is where most companies cut corners, but it’s the most important step for preventing mold and structural damage later.

Most homeowner’s insurance policies cover water damage from sudden and accidental events like burst pipes, appliance failures, or storm damage through your roof. However, flooding from external sources typically requires separate flood insurance.

We work directly with insurance companies and handle all the documentation and communication with adjusters. This includes detailed moisture mapping, photo documentation of damages, and proper categorization of water damage according to industry standards.

The key is acting quickly. Insurance companies can deny claims if they determine you waited too long to address the damage, considering it neglect. That’s why we recommend calling us immediately when you discover water damage, even before calling your insurance company.

We handle all categories of water damage common to Huntington properties. This includes clean water from burst pipes or appliance leaks, gray water from washing machines or dishwashers, and black water from sewage backups or storm flooding.

Huntington’s location on Long Island Sound means we regularly deal with storm surge damage, especially in waterfront properties. We also handle basement flooding from high water tables, which is common in many Huntington neighborhoods, particularly during heavy rain seasons.

Each type of water damage requires different approaches and safety protocols. Our technicians are trained in IICRC standards and equipped with proper protective equipment to handle contaminated water safely while protecting your family’s health.

Mold prevention starts with complete moisture removal within 24-48 hours of the initial water damage. We use industrial-grade dehumidifiers, high-velocity air movers, and thermal imaging cameras to detect hidden moisture that standard equipment might miss.

Our drying process follows strict protocols with daily moisture readings to ensure we’re making progress. We don’t just dry surfaces – we dry the structure itself, including inside wall cavities and under flooring where moisture can hide and create perfect conditions for mold growth.

If materials like drywall or insulation are too saturated to dry properly, we remove them rather than risk mold problems later. It’s better to replace a section of drywall than deal with a mold remediation project that affects your entire home.

First, ensure your safety. If there’s any possibility of electrical hazards, turn off power to the affected area at the circuit breaker. Don’t walk through standing water if electrical outlets or appliances might be submerged.

Stop the water source if possible and safe to do so. This might mean shutting off your main water supply or covering a damaged roof area. Then call us immediately for emergency response – don’t wait to see if the situation improves on its own.

Document the damage with photos for insurance purposes, but don’t start moving belongings or attempting cleanup until professionals assess the situation. Well-meaning cleanup efforts can sometimes make the damage worse or create safety hazards you weren’t aware of.

Emergency water extraction usually begins within hours of our arrival and can take anywhere from a few hours to a full day depending on the amount of water involved. The drying process typically takes 3-5 days with proper equipment and monitoring.

Complete restoration depends on the extent of damage. Minor flooding with quick response might only require drying and minor repairs, taking less than a week. Extensive damage involving flooring replacement, wall repair, or reconstruction can take several weeks.
